cc2530之间是如何通信的

在物联网时代,cc2530作为一款低功耗、高性能的无线微控制器,其通信方式一直是众多开发者**的焦点。**将深入解析cc2530之间的通信机制,帮助读者全面了解这一技术,从而在实际应用中更加得心应手。
一、cc2530通信基础
1.cc2530通信原理
cc2530采用IEEE802.15.4标准,通过2.4GHz频段的无线信号进行通信。其通信原理基于ZigBee协议,支持点对点、点对多点和广播等多种通信模式。
二、cc2530通信方式
2.直接通信
cc2530之间可以直接通信,实现设备间的数据交换。这种方式适用于近距离通信,如家庭自动化、工业控制等领域。
3.间接通信
当cc2530设备较多时,可以通过一个或多个协调器(Coordinator)设备进行间接通信。协调器负责路由和地址分配,使得设备间能够实现通信。
4.网络拓扑结构
cc2530通信网络可以采用星型、树型和网状等拓扑结构。星型拓扑结构简单易实现,适用于小型网络;网状拓扑结构具有较强的抗干扰能力和扩展性,适用于大型网络。
三、cc2530通信配置
5.*件配置
cc2530通信需要配置相应的*件,如天线、**模块等。合理选择*件,可以提高通信质量和稳定性。
6.软件配置
cc2530通信的软件配置主要包括设置工作信道、数据速率、地址模式等。正确配置软件参数,可以优化通信性能。
四、cc2530通信优化
7.抗干扰能力
cc2530通信过程中,可能会受到电磁干扰。通过优化通信参数,如调整发射功率、选择合适的信道等,可以降低干扰对通信的影响。
8.数据传输速率
cc2530支持多种数据传输速率,如250kbps、500kbps、1Mbps等。根据实际需求选择合适的速率,可以提高通信效率。
五、cc2530通信应用
9.家庭自动化
cc2530在家庭自动化领域的应用广泛,如智能照明、智能安防等。通过cc2530实现设备间的通信,构建智能家居系统。
10.工业控制
cc2530在工业控制领域的应用也较为广泛,如传感器网络、无线数据采集等。通过cc2530实现设备间的通信,提高工业自动化水平。
cc2530之间的通信方式多样,通过合理配置*件和软件,可以实现稳定、高效的无线通信。在实际应用中,根据具体需求选择合适的通信方式和拓扑结构,将有助于提高物联网系统的性能和可靠性。